Description

Cyclohexanecarboxaldehyde, 4,4-Difluoro- (9Ci) is a specialized fluorinated aldehyde building block, identified by CAS number 265108-36-9. This compound is valued for its unique chemical structure, which introduces both aldehyde functionality and fluorine atoms onto a cyclohexane ring, enabling precise modifications in advanced synthetic pathways. It is primarily sought by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and advanced materials sectors for creating novel molecules with tailored properties.

Application

  • Pharmaceutical Intermediate: A key synthon for the development of fluorinated active pharmaceutical ingredients (APIs), where fluorine atoms can enhance metabolic stability, bioavailability, and binding affinity.
  • Agrochemical Synthesis: Used in the research and production of new-generation herbicides, fungicides, and pesticides that benefit from the lipophilicity and stability imparted by fluorine.
  • Liquid Crystal & OLED Materials: Serves as a precursor in the synthesis of fluorinated organic compounds for electronic displays and optoelectronic devices.
  • Organic Synthesis & Catalysis: Employed as a versatile electrophile in various reactions, including reductive amination, Grignard additions, and as a ligand precursor in catalyst design.
  • Fluorine Chemistry Research: An important reagent for academic and industrial research exploring the effects of fluorine substitution on physical and chemical properties.
  • Polymer Modification: Can be used to introduce aldehyde and fluorine functional groups into polymer backbones for specialty materials with specific surface or bulk characteristics.

Basic Information

Product Name Cyclohexanecarboxaldehyde, 4,4-Difluoro- (9Ci)
CAS No. 265108-36-9
Molecular Formula C7H10F2O
Molecular Weight 148.15 g/mol
Synonyms 4,4-Difluorocyclohexanecarboxaldehyde; 4,4-Difluorocyclohexanecarbaldehyde; 4,4-Difluorocyclohexane-1-carbaldehyde; 4,4-Difluorocyclohexylcarboxaldehyde; 4,4-Difluorocyclohexylcarbaldehyde; 4,4-Difluorocyclohexane-1-carboxaldehyde; 4,4-Difluorocyclohexanecarbonal; (4,4-Difluorocyclohexyl)methanal

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at room temperature (15-25°C). This material is easily oxidized and should be stored under an inert atmosphere (e.g., nitrogen or argon) for long-term stability. Keep away from strong oxidizing agents, strong bases, and reducing agents.
